Maynard, Kenneth Douglas was born on August 16, 1931 in Hackensack, New Jersey, United States. Son of Douglas Harry and Eva (Whiting) Maynard.
Certified in Architecture, University Natal, Durban, Republic of South Africa, 1958.
Draftsman, Morross & Graff, Johannesburg, Republic of South Africa, 1950-1951; draftsman, Anglo-American Corporation, Johannesburg, Republic of South Africa, 1951-1954; draftsman, Moir & Llewellyn, Empangeni, Zululand., Republic of South Africa, 1955-1957; architect, Pearse Aneck-Hahn & Bristol, Johannesburg, 1957-1960; architect, Manley & Mayer, Anchorage, 1960-1961; architect, Federal Aviation Administration, Anchorage, 1961-1962; architect, Crittenden Cassetta Wirum & Jacobs, Anchorage, 1962-1965; principal, Schultz & Maynard, Anchorage, 1965-1968; principal, Kenneth Maynard Associations, Anchorage, 1968-1978; president, Maynard & Partch, Anchorage, 1978-1996; principal, USKH, Inc., Anchorage, since 1996.
Active Western Alaska Council Boy Scouts. American, Anchorage, 1965-1984. Board directors Salvation Army Advisory Board, Anchorage, 1981-1987, Anchorage Museum Association, 1969-1986, Anchorage Opera Company, 1983-1990.
Chairman Mayor's Comprehensive Homeless Program Strategy Group, 1992-1994. Fellow: American Institute of Architects (president Alaska chapter 1969, Northwest regional representative for national committee on design 1976-1989, national board 1999—2001). Member: Construction Specification Institute (president Cook Inlet chapter 1993-1994).
Married Myrna Myrtle James, February 4, 1956. Children: Colin, Vivien Noll.
